How to fill out form 8332 rev

Illustration

How to fill out form 8332 rev:

01
Obtain a copy of form 8332 rev from the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) website or your tax preparation software.
02
Gather the necessary information, including your personal details, the details of the child or children for whom you are granting the exemption, and any other relevant information.
03
Begin filling out the form by entering your name, Social Security number, and tax year at the top.
04
Provide the name, Social Security number, and relationship to you for each qualifying child.
05
Indicate the specific years or periods for which you are releasing the claim to the child's exemption by selecting the appropriate checkboxes.
06
Sign and date the form.
07
Keep a copy of the completed form for your records.

Form 8332 rev is a tax form used by taxpayers to release their claim to an exemption for a child or dependent to the noncustodial parent or another taxpayer.
The custodial parent or taxpayer claiming an exemption for a child or dependent is required to file form 8332 rev to release their claim to the noncustodial parent or another taxpayer.
To fill out form 8332 rev, you need to provide your personal information, such as name, address, and taxpayer identification number (TIN). You also need to provide information about the child or dependent being claimed, including their name, TIN, and the tax year for which you are releasing the claim.
The purpose of form 8332 rev is to allow the custodial parent or taxpayer claiming an exemption to release their claim to the noncustodial parent or another taxpayer, allowing them to claim the exemption instead.
Form 8332 rev requires the reporting of personal information, such as name, address, and TIN, for both the custodial and noncustodial parents or taxpayers. It also requires the reporting of information about the child or dependent being claimed, including their name, TIN, and the tax year for which the claim is being released.
